Transaction 04889b084aadeebed278a23f6552f7b641ee941b0216360d5ebe55cd25a0ae6a
1 Input
1 Output
-
04889b084aadeebed278a23f6552f7b641ee941b0216360d5ebe55cd25a0ae6a:0
- value
- 95490
- script pubkey
- OP_0 OP_PUSHBYTES_20 39acb8ea1f26451155b642b13898cb25658e8a30
- address
- bc1q8xkt36slyez3z4dkg2cn3xxty4jcaz3sp5h68p